This article explains about what are
the different forms of a CD like CD, CD-ROM, CD-R and CD-RW and what are the differences.
The compact disk (CD) audio system
was released in 1983. The compact disk (CD) can store the audio information of one
hour in the digital form on one side and it is a non-erasable disk.
CD-ROM
is non erasable disk which has the capacity of storing 650 MB of memory so it can
be used for sharing huge data.
CD-R is a CD recordable in which the user can write to the disk only once.It can
be treated as write one-ready many.
